Scirtes khnzoryani Kirejtshuk and Ponomarenko 2019 (marsh beetle)

Insecta - Coleoptera - Scirtidae

Full reference: A. G. Kirejtshuk and A. G. Ponomarenko. 2019. Taxonomic names, in The beetle (Coleoptera) fauna of the Insect Limestone (late Eocene), Isle of Wight, southern England. Earth and Environmental Science Transactions of the Royal Society of Edinburgh 110:405-492

Belongs to Scirtes according to A. G. Kirejtshuk and A. G. Ponomarenko 2019

Sister taxa: Eohelodites, Scirtes calcariferens, Scirtes circumcisus, Scirtes metepisternalis, Scirtes orbiculatus, Scirtes wightensis

Type specimen: NHMUK In.25597, an exoskeleton. Its type locality is Bembridge Marls (Hooley coll), which is in a Priabonian lagoonal/restricted shallow subtidal lime mudstone in the Bouldnor Formation of the United Kingdom.
